Output d21fc0ed28171b281df400a04749190988fca04e91317fde2d316cc60ea083fc:5

value
1439781
script pubkey
OP_0 OP_PUSHBYTES_20 4c3f91ee33899c7bf36efcd458dca24bd44243c3
address
bc1qfslerm3n3xw8humwln293h9zf02yys7rvlmkwe
transaction
d21fc0ed28171b281df400a04749190988fca04e91317fde2d316cc60ea083fc
confirmations
1600
spent
true